#58cab9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58cab9 is composed of 34.5% red, 79.2%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 171.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 56.9%. #58cab9 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#009573.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#58cab9 color description : Moderate cyan.
#58cab9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58cab9 has RGB values of R:88, G:202,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 5819065.

Shades and Tints of #58cab9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c0a is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#58cab9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9795 is the less saturated color, while #25fddd is the most saturated one.
